Earth Hour at Media Rotana

Media Rotana celebrated Earth Hour together with the rest of the world as an action to fight climate change. Students from different schools in Dubai came together to express how much they care for the environment and raise awareness about climate change. They collectively shared their talents and reflections to mark the importance of this event to the delight of the audience. 

 

“Media Rotana is participating annually in the Earth Hour, it is our commitment to the preservation of land and sustainable development, and all these initiatives and competitions are aimed at raising awareness and understanding of the importance of individual efforts to contribute to the preservation of the environment and land", commented Sherif Madkour, the General Manager of Media Rotana.

 

A Grade 10 and musical genius, named Mikhail Potvar, beautifully performed “Italy O Sole Mio” with his violin. Action songs were rendered by Sofia Sison, Gabriella Alexander, Addison Alexander, Masa Al Far, Hashem Al Far, Karma Al Ghaith, Youanna Lawendy, Aylin Babacan, Elias Ahad, Junting Lin, and Angel Malihan creatively with glowing hands and feet. 

 

The performance started 15 minutes before the scheduled event, to give time for the children to share their thoughts in the light to the audience of the Media Rotana Earth Hour. At exactly 8:30 pm, all lights were turned off that offered a serene feeling all around. The Media Rotana team customarily lit candles that were assembled to form the Rotana motif. 

 

Earth Hour is just one of the many CSR activities lined up this year. There are still more exciting projects belonging to its sustainability plan to look forward to very, very soon.
